Police evacuated an EU building and cordoned off the main road in the European Quarters in Brussels, Belgium, on June 3. The evacuation was reportedly prompted by the report of a "suspicious luggage" in the area. 

The building evacuated was the Copernicus building, home to the digital department DG Connect within the EU Commission. One staffer told Politico: "We haven’t been told what’s going on." The news outlet added a police officer was overheard telling people that a suspicious luggage had reported in the area. 

Earlier, at 1.15 local time (12.15 BST), the commission informed staff told staff of a police intervention over a "suspicious item" in front of Loi 65. It urged workers to: "Stay away from the windows" and "Avoid the area.”

But in a follow-up message at 2:20 pm local time (1.20pm BST), the commission said: “Police intervention near the building finished. Situation back to normal,” as per Politico.
